
Dunedin City Council announced this afternoon the public section of the Wall Street car park, which is in St Andrew St, will be be closed from April 1 for two months of repairs.
Repairs were needed to the car park deck, some steel screen sections and a couple of seismic joints, the council said in a statement.
The work was needed because two seismic joints had reached the end of their serviceable life and needed replacing.
Similar work was done on two different joints in March last year.
The south side of the car park will be open to leaseholders only, but the north side – which has about 40 public car parks – will be closed while this work is done.
A second stage of work, more suited to warmer, drier weather, would be done in spring.
The work will cost between $500,000 and $750,000.
